Description

Add support for connecting to existing external MCP servers via endpoint URLs, without scaffolding new code.

  • Source step in wizard: New "Existing endpoint" vs "Create new" selection when adding a gateway target
  • External endpoint flow: When "Existing endpoint" is selected, prompts for endpoint URL and skips language/host steps. Creates target in mcp.json with targetType: 'mcpServer' and endpoint field — no files scaffolded to app/mcp/
  • Unassigned targets: "Skip for now" option in gateway selection stores targets in unassignedTargets[] array in mcp.json for later assignment
  • CLI flags: --type, --source, --endpoint for non-interactive usage (e.g. agentcore add gateway-target --name my-target --source existing-endpoint --endpoint https://example.com/mcp)
  • Schema: Added unassignedTargets field to AgentCoreMcpSpecSchema

* feat: display gateway target sync status after deploy (#419)

Query ListGatewayTargets after successful deployment and display
sync status for each target:
- READY: ✓ synced
- SYNCHRONIZING: ⟳ syncing...
- FAILED: ✗ failed

Integrated into both CLI and TUI deploy paths. TUI uses React state
for proper rendering. API errors are non-blocking — deploy succeeds
regardless of status query result.

* refactor: remove gateway bind flow from add gateway TUI (#431)

Gateways are project-level in Phase 1 — all agents get all gateways
automatically via CDK env vars. The bind-agent-to-gateway flow was
pre-Phase 1 code that is no longer needed.

Add gateway now goes straight to the create wizard.

* feat: add gateway auth and multi-gateway support to agent templates (#427)

* feat: add gateway auth support to agent templates

Add SigV4 authentication to MCP client templates so agents can
authenticate with AWS_IAM gateways. Each framework's client.py
uses Handlebars conditionals to include auth when gateways exist.

SigV4HTTPXAuth class signs HTTP requests using botocore SigV4Auth,
passed to the MCP client via httpx.AsyncClient. Templates read
gateway URLs from AGENTCORE_GATEWAY_{NAME}_URL env vars and handle
missing vars gracefully (warn, don't crash).

Updated all 5 frameworks: Strands, LangChain, OpenAI Agents,
Google ADK, AutoGen. Schema mapper reads mcp.json to populate
gateway config for template rendering. All gateways are auto-
included when creating an agent.

* fix: CDK template types and credential ARN passthrough for gateway deploy (#432)

* fix: correct CDK template type names and prop names

The CDK stack template used McpSpec (doesn't exist) instead of
AgentCoreMcpSpec, and passed wrong prop names to AgentCoreMcp:
- spec → mcpSpec
- application → agentCoreApplication
- Added missing projectName prop

* fix: collect API key credential ARNs and write to deployed state before CDK synth

API key credential providers were created during deploy but their ARNs
were not stored in deployed state, causing CDK to fail with 'Credential
not found in deployed state' for gateway targets with API key auth.

- Return credentialProviderArn from create/update API key providers
- Unify API key and OAuth credential ARNs into single deployed state map
- Move credential setup before CDK synth so template can read ARNs
- Write partial deployed state with credentials before synth

* fix: pass credential ARNs from deployed state to CDK gateway construct

CDK template now reads deployed-state.json and extracts credential
provider ARNs per target, passing them to AgentCoreMcp so gateway
targets can reference outbound auth credentials.
